Bournemouth defender Nathan Ake: Brother gave up career for me

Bournemouth defender Nathan Ake has revealed how his brother gave up his career to help him be successful.

Cedric gave up his own promising career in Holland for Nathan to develop his in England.

“My brother came from Holland to Chelsea with me, when I was 16," he told the Mirror. “I had to go in digs and he lived in Kingston. He basically gave his life up for me to have someone there on the weekends.

“We've always been close. He is four years older and was a really good player.

“At the age of 18 or 19, he got a move to Ado Den Haag, a professional club. He could have made the first team.

“But I went to Chelsea and he said, 'OK I want to support you and help you', so basically he gave up his football to help me."
